HTML怎么传本地图片(详解HTML本地图片上传方法)
导读:摘要:本文将详细介绍HTML本地图片上传方法,包括图片上传的基本原理、代码实现以及相关注意事项。1. 基本原理putData对象进行表单数据的封装,最后通过XMLHttpRequest对象向服务器发送POST请求,即可将图片上传至服务器。2...
摘要:本文将详细介绍HTML本地图片上传方法,包括图片上传的基本原理、代码实现以及相关注意事项。
1. 基本原理
putData对象进行表单数据的封装,最后通过XMLHttpRequest对象向服务器发送POST请求,即可将图片上传至服务器。
2. 代码实现
首先,需要在HTML中创建一个文件选择框:
putput">
接着,通过JavaScript代码获取用户选择的图片:
putententByIdput'); put.files[0];
Data对象,并将选中的图片添加到其中:
DataewData(); Datad('file', file);
Data对象作为参数传递:
ew XMLHttpRequest(); ('POST', '/upload', true); loadction () {
// 上传成功后的处理代码
} ; dData);
3. 注意事项
在使用HTML本地图片上传时,需要注意以下几点:
(1)文件选择框必须设置为type="file",否则无法选择本地图片;
Data对象时,必须将选中的图片作为参数,且参数名必须与服务器端的接收参数名一致;
(3)在上传大文件时,应该考虑使用分片上传,以避免上传失败的情况发生。
总之,HTML本地图片上传是一种非常简单、实用的技术,可以方便地将本地图片上传至服务器,为网站的开发和维护提供了很大的便利。
声明:本文内容由网友自发贡献,本站不承担相应法律责任。对本内容有异议或投诉,请联系2913721942#qq.com核实处理,我们将尽快回复您,谢谢合作!
若转载请注明出处: HTML怎么传本地图片(详解HTML本地图片上传方法)
本文地址: https://pptw.com/jishu/267164.html
